Reseña del editor:
Struggling with loneliness and job dissatisfaction, food stylist Julia Daniel works with her friends and therapist to fend off such challenges as the deaths of her parents, a neurotic boss, and a pilfering step-sister, and when an unexpected turn takes place at her job, she endeavors to start over.
